Types of Pallets You Should Know

A successful buying and selling pallets business depends on understanding the different types of pallets available in the market. The most common types include:

Wood Pallets

Wood pallets are the most widely used due to their affordability and availability. They are easy to repair and recycle, making them a popular choice for many industries.

Plastic Pallets

Plastic pallets are durable, resistant to moisture, and ideal for industries that require hygiene, such as food and pharmaceuticals.

Metal Pallets

Metal pallets are designed for heavy-duty use and are commonly used in industrial settings where strength and durability are essential.

Composite Pallets

Composite pallets combine different materials to provide strength and sustainability. They are gaining popularity as eco-friendly alternatives.

Understanding these pallet types allows you to meet customer needs effectively and build trust in your buying and selling pallets business.

Analyzing Market Demand and Pricing

Market research is a critical step in buying and selling pallets. Pricing depends on several factors, including material type, pallet condition, size, and market demand. New pallets typically command higher prices, while used or refurbished pallets offer cost-effective solutions for buyers.

Demand for pallets is driven by industries such as logistics, e-commerce, and manufacturing. By identifying which sectors are growing in your area, you can focus your efforts on high-demand markets.

To stay competitive in buying and selling pallets, regularly analyze competitor pricing and adjust your strategy to attract customers while maintaining profitability.

Inspecting and Sorting Pallets

Quality control is critical in buying and selling pallets. Customers expect durable and reliable pallets, so it is important to inspect every unit before selling.

Check for damage such as broken boards, loose nails, or structural weaknesses. Remove defective pallets from your inventory to maintain your reputation.

Sorting pallets based on condition and specifications improves efficiency. Categorize them as new, used, or refurbished, and organize them by size and load capacity. This makes it easier to fulfill orders and manage inventory effectively.

Proper Storage and Handling

Proper storage is essential in buying and selling pallets to maintain product quality. Store pallets in a clean, dry environment to prevent damage from moisture or pests.

Use safe stacking techniques to avoid accidents and ensure stability. Train your staff on proper handling procedures to reduce damage during transportation and storage.

Efficient storage practices not only protect your inventory but also improve overall operations in your buying and selling pallets business.
